04 Conditions for Being Promoted to Pilot Technical Rank in the Vietnam People's Army

This is an important provision in Circular 120/2020/TT-BQP issued by the Ministry of National Defense, stipulating the technical classification of pilots and crew members in the Vietnam People's Army, promulgated on October 06, 2020.

To be specific:, Article 25 of Circular 120/2020/TT-BQP stipulates that pilots and crew members are annually ranked when they meet the following 04 conditions:

  1. Meet the classification standards stipulated in Chapter III of this Circular;
  2. Have annual flight hours reach ≥ 80% of the required flight hours;
  3. No flight safety threats or accidents occurred during practice flights in the year;
  4. Classification examination results: Theory scores in each subject are quite good or higher (for rank 1, each subject score must be 7.5 or higher on a scale of 10, and the overall average score must be excellent). Airborne training (if applicable) must be quite good or higher. Physical fitness training must be quite good or higher. Political awareness and discipline training must be good. Flight practice must be quite good or higher for rank 2 and rank 3; excellent for rank 1.

Note: Each pilot and crew member can only be ranked once a year and cannot be ranked above their current level.

Additionally, pilots and crew members who have been ranked can maintain their level annually when they meet the following requirements:

- For military pilots and crew members ranked 1:

- Complete annual tasks: Training flight hours target reach ≥ 60%; mission flight hours target reach ≥ 60%;- No more than one flight safety threat caused by themselves;- Classification examination results: General theory score is quite good; airborne training (if applicable) is quite good; physical fitness training is quite good; political awareness and discipline training is good; flight practice is quite good.

- For military pilots and crew members ranked 2:

- Do not meet the standards for rank 1;- Complete annual tasks: Training flight hours target reach ≥ 70%; mission flight hours target reach ≥ 70%;- No more than one flight safety threat caused by themselves;- Classification examination results: General theory score is quite good; airborne training (if applicable) is quite good; physical fitness training is quite good; political awareness and discipline training is good; flight practice is quite good.

- For military pilots and crew members ranked 3:

- Do not meet the standards for rank 2;- Complete annual tasks: Training flight hours target reach ≥ 80%; mission flight hours target reach ≥ 80%;- No more than one flight safety threat caused by themselves;- Classification examination results: General theory score is quite good; airborne training (if applicable) is quite good; physical fitness training is quite good; political awareness and discipline training is good; flight practice is quite good.

For details, please refer to Circular 120/2020/TT-BQP, effective from January 1, 2021.
